Unix开发环境搭建:快速入门与实战指南

在Unix开发环境中,选择合适的操作系统是第一步。常见的Unix变种包括Linux、macOS以及Solaris等。对于初学者来说,推荐使用Ubuntu或Debian这类用户友好的Linux发行版,它们拥有庞大的社区支持和丰富的软件包。

AI绘图,仅供参考

安装完成后,配置开发环境需要安装必要的工具链。例如,GCC编译器、Make构建工具以及版本控制工具Git。这些工具通常可以通过包管理器(如apt或yum)轻松安装。确保系统更新至最新状态,以避免兼容性问题。

文本编辑器和IDE的选择也会影响开发效率。Vim和Emacs是经典的命令行编辑器,适合熟悉键盘操作的开发者。而Visual Studio Code或JetBrains系列则提供了更直观的图形界面和强大的插件生态。

环境变量的设置对开发流程至关重要。通过修改~/.bashrc或~/.zshrc文件,可以自定义PATH、EDITOR等变量,提升命令行使用的便捷性。•SSH密钥配置有助于安全地访问远程服务器。

实战中,建议从简单的C或Python项目开始。编写一个“Hello World”程序并尝试编译运行,有助于理解整个开发流程。同时,利用git进行代码版本管理,能够有效跟踪代码变更并协作开发。

•持续学习和实践是掌握Unix开发的关键。参与开源项目、阅读技术文档以及关注社区动态,都能帮助提升技能水平。

dawei

【声明】:北京站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。